| The Project
Scope |
| |
| The Project aims to
provide the focus for regional development in the NDR and SDR
thereby supporting more equitable
development in the country and taking some of the pressure
off Male', the capital.
The project will improve the living
environment of the inhabitants of focus islands in
NDR and in the SDR. The project includes construction of permanent
regional development
and management offices (RDMOS) in both Kulhudhuffushi and
Hithadhoo, training local staff,
upgrading of a 10.5 km road from Gan to Hithadhoo, upgrading
of streets in urban areas of the focus islands, provision of rain
water collection and
storage for 2000 individual households in both the NDR and SDR,
provision of appropriate technology solutions
to sanitation for 1000, individual households
in the NDR, construction of a 70-metre (m) bridge and 200 m
culverted causeway
in SDR (for environmental reasons); provision of solid waste
disposal, septic
tank desludging, and the setting up of permanent environmental
monitoring of the
freshwater lens, coastal geomorphology, and marine ecology of the
focus islands. |
